The Dark Urge Revelation

A dedicated Baldur’s Gate 3 enthusiast recently uncovered the Dark Urge origin character during their standard gameplay experience, leaving the community astonished at having overlooked this significant detail.

When players initially select the Dark Urge origin in Baldur’s Gate 3, they encounter layers of mystery surrounding this complex character. Fortunately, as the narrative unfolds, crucial backstory elements gradually emerge. These revelations typically align with the disturbing expectations players might have for such a tormented being, yet many develop unexpected affection for this deeply flawed protagonist.

Standard Tav playthroughs typically exclude encounters with the Durge character, distinguishing it from other origin options that manifest as potential party members. This changed when an observant player identified the recognizable twisted persona within their conventional gameplay, sparking widespread appreciation for the narrative cohesion.

Understanding Durge’s Role in BG3

“This explains the complete absence of Durge during standard Tav adventures” shared a community member on the Baldur’s Gate 3 discussion platform. The player accompanied their breakthrough with visual evidence showing the characteristic Durge figure deceased within a blood-drenched Bhaal symbol, positioned adjacent to Orin’s resting area.

Seasoned Dark Urge players understand this character’s heritage as a Bhaalspawn and former leadership within the Cult of Bhaal. The narrative reveals their betrayal by sibling Orin, who inflicted memory loss to seize control. In conventional playthroughs, instead of experiencing betrayal and curses, the character meets permanent demise as a sacrificial offering to Bhaal.

Following this discovery’s publication, community members expressed astonishment at their previous oversight: “I’m amazed I never recognized this connection! I recall suspecting deeper narrative layers but never made the crucial association.”

Some players found the sacrificial presentation particularly disrespectful, with numerous comments including: “Observe how they’ve destroyed my favorite character” and “Seriously, Orin simply abandoned them there? At minimum, position the body correctly, you careless slob. Typical chaotic shapeshifter conduct.”

Despite the imperfect placement of Durge’s remains, such intricate details amplify appreciation for Baldur’s Gate 3’s design philosophy, as players continually unearth new hidden elements and subtle references throughout their adventures.

Mastering Character Exploration Techniques

To maximize your discovery potential in Baldur’s Gate 3, implement systematic area examination methods. The Temple of Bhaal requires particular attention during Act 3, with thorough inspection of Orin’s personal quarters being essential. Many players overlook peripheral details while focused on primary objectives, missing crucial environmental storytelling elements.
